Applikationshinweise
-
Western Blot: Approx 40-45 kDa band observed in nuclear cell lysates of NIH3T3 (calculated MW of 42.8 kDa according to Mouse NP_570930.1). Recommended concentration: 0.3-1 μg/mL.
Peptide ELISA: antibody detection limit dilution 1:8000.
